You basically have to keep looking at the different classes until you've memorized them. Remember basic representative samples from each class, then learn the ones that deviate.
You mean drug of choice for a given disease process? You don't really need to know that kind of information for Step 1...more the mechanisms of action, common indications for THAT CLASS of medication, common side-effects and contraindications.
